You think you're a decent and courteous driver but then sometimes when you get so tired you give in to your own frustration and find yourself shouting to another driver who took a little bit too long to react to the green light. Is it just aggressive driving or an act of road rage? Are you aware if you're prone to road rage?Road rage involves rude, explosive and confrontational behavior which often leads to an act of criminal violence. Aggressive driving, on the other hand, is merely a traffic offense due to careless and inconsiderate driving such as running red lights, tailgating and unsafe lane changes. Road rage and aggressive driving is not too far removed from each other. While there are major differences between the two, aggressive driving can easily lead to road rage if the driver succumbs to his frustrations.
